Finding Your Palette: Considerations Before You Paint

Before diving into specific colors, consider these crucial factors:

  • Room Size and Lighting: Small rooms benefit from lighter, brighter colors that reflect light and create an illusion of space. Darker shades can make a large room feel cozier and more intimate. Natural light plays a significant role; a room with abundant sunlight can handle bolder colors, while a dimly lit space requires colors that maximize brightness.
  • Personal Style: Your bedroom should reflect your personality. Consider your existing furniture, bedding, and décor. Do you prefer a minimalist aesthetic, a bohemian vibe, or a classic, traditional style? The paint color should complement and enhance your overall vision.
  • Color Psychology: Colors evoke different emotions. Blues and greens are generally considered calming and serene, ideal for promoting restful sleep. Warmer tones like yellows and oranges can create a sense of warmth and energy, but may not be suitable for those seeking a tranquil atmosphere.
  • Undertones: Pay close attention to undertones. Even seemingly neutral colors like white and gray can have warm (yellow, red) or cool (blue, green) undertones that can drastically alter their appearance in different lighting conditions. Test paint samples in your room before committing to a specific color.

Beyond Solid Colors: Creative Painting Techniques

Elevate your bedroom walls with these creative painting techniques:

  • Ombre Walls: Create a gradient effect by blending two or more colors together. This technique adds depth and visual interest to the room.
  • Stripes: Vertical stripes can make a room appear taller, while horizontal stripes can make it appear wider. Use contrasting colors for a bold statement or subtle variations for a more understated look.
  • Geometric Patterns: Use painter's tape to create geometric patterns on your walls. Triangles, squares, and hexagons can add a modern and artistic touch.
  • Stenciling: Use stencils to add intricate designs to your walls. Floral patterns, geometric motifs, and custom lettering are all popular options.
  • Textured Paint: Add depth and dimension to your walls with textured paint. Techniques like rag rolling, sponging, and stippling can create a unique and tactile surface.

Expert Tips for a Flawless Paint Job

Achieving a professional-looking paint job requires careful preparation and attention to detail:

  • Prepare the Walls: Clean the walls thoroughly and repair any holes or cracks. Use a primer to create a smooth and even surface for the paint to adhere to.
  • Choose the Right Paint: Select a high-quality paint that is specifically formulated for bedrooms. Consider using a paint with low VOCs (volatile organic compounds) for better air quality.
  • Use the Right Tools: Invest in quality brushes, rollers, and painter's tape. These tools will make the painting process easier and more efficient.
  • Apply Multiple Coats: Apply at least two coats of paint for optimal coverage and durability. Allow each coat to dry completely before applying the next.
  • Take Your Time: Don't rush the painting process. Take your time and pay attention to detail to ensure a flawless finish.
